Nicholas John “Nick” Bruno Jr., born on November 14, 1939, in Trenton, New Jersey, passed away on Friday, March 21, 2025, at the age of 85 due to advanced Parkinson’s Disease.
Nick was the beloved husband of Mary Elizabeth Bruno and a devoted father to Mike (Beth) Bruno, Jim (Melissa) Bruno, and Juli (Pete) Foran. He was also a proud grandfather to seven beautiful granddaughters: Sydney, Paige, Morgan, Avery, Madelyn, McKenna, Olivia; and two great-grandchildren: Barrett and Emberly.
Nick grew up in Trenton, New Jersey, as the middle child of Stella and Nick Sr. He graduated from Saint Vincent College and later joined the Marines. After his service, Nick pursued a career in the manufacturing industry, went on to earn a master’s degree from Xavier University, and continued to advance through various management positions, ultimately retiring in Summerville, South Carolina. During his retirement, Nick enjoyed spending time outdoors, working in his yard, volunteering at Mepkin Abbey, and playing golf.
Nick was a loving husband and father who instilled the values of hard work, family, and independence in his children. He will be remembered by all who loved him as a devoted family man and a person of deep Catholic faith who cherished time with his family.
Nick is survived by his loving wife, Liz; his children: Mike, Jim, Juli; his seven grandchildren; and two great grandchildren. He is also survived by his younger sister, Maureen Nicolai. He was preceded in death by his parents and older sister, Lucielle Bruno.
Nick’s memory will live on in the hearts of those who knew and loved him.
